What Wedding Accessories Are Needed To Be A Vintage Bride

By James Riley




Did you like The Great Gatsby? Downtown Abbey? How about lacy dresses and lots of bling? Well if you said yes you're not alone. Many brides have fallen in love with the idea of vintage, 1920's wedding day. The wedding industry has taken notice and you too can get that beautiful look from days gone by. Here are some easy to accomplish steps you can follow to make your big day one to remember.

Choosing a Classic Color Palate: Choosing the right colors for your vintage wedding will help set the scene and will take your wedding guests back in time. Use muted colors like beige, ivory, toupe, or stone grey. Once you've established a few base colors, add an accent color like siege green, vintage rose pink, peachy orange, or deep purple.

Let's take a look at the Bride: When looking for that vintage styled dress you must keep a few things in mind. First you will have to ignore the pull you feel to grab that white princess dress you saw in your recent issue of The Knot. Vintage brides must instead take a look at those ivory and blush numbers. Next you should be picking a mermaid, fit and flare, or a A-line dress. As always getting the perfect fit is imperative for every bride. When dressing up that dress, your going to want to grab some LONG strands of pearls and some BIG gem earrings. This is no time to be conservative, in the case of the vintage bride you want to go HUGE with the wedding accessories. Now your going to do my favorite part; your going to go with the birdcage veil. You can get a small subtle birdcage or go all out and get one that just about covers half your body! Let yourself have fun with this part. Next you should grab a long strapped purse and some elbow length gloves to round out that stunning look.

Vintage Bouquet: To create the perfect bouquet for the vintage bride use your favorite flowers in muted colors. If you want to be real creative go with the trendy broach bouquet made with vintage antiques.

The Wedding Reception: Make sure your center pieces pull your vintage theme together. Here you should let your creative side out! Utilize feathers, gems, and lots of sparkle! Use muted colors and throw in your favorite flowers. When your picking out your musical playlist throw away the Ipod and fire the DJ. Hire a jazz band! Your wedding guests will be wowed by this classy touch and will definitely be remembered. And why not let the organ rest and walk down the aisle to the music of the band while your at it?

Remind your guests of your roaring 20's wedding day and let them know they are more than welcome to join in the fun and wear vintage suits and dresses. Set your bridesmaids up with short dresses with lots of detailing. Have them complete their look by wearing lots of beads and a vintage headband.
